Principal Product Manager (Data)
UK Multiple Locations
Full Time | up to £90,000
A leading digital consultancy delivering large-scale transformation programmes across the public and private sectors is looking for a Principal Product Manager (Data) to lead the strategy and delivery of innovative data products and platforms.
What You’ll Have the Opportunity to Do: *Lead the vision, strategy and roadmap for complex data products and services
*Work closely with senior stakeholders to shape priorities and investment decisions
*Translate business and technical requirements into clear product outcomes
*Lead multidisciplinary teams across product, engineering, data and design
*Drive discovery, delivery and continuous improvement activities
*Partner with Data Engineers, Architects and Analysts to deliver high-value solutions
*Mentor Product Managers and contribute to the growth of the wider product community
*Support business development activities through client engagement and bid work
About the Candidate
The successful Principal Product Manager (Data) will have: *Strong experience delivering complex data products, platforms or services
*A proven background in product strategy, roadmaps and prioritisation
*Experience working alongside Data Engineering, Analytics and Architecture teams
*Knowledge of data architecture, data modelling and governance principles
*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ills
*Experience influencing senior leaders and driving strategic decisions
*A track record of leading multidisciplinary teams in Agile environments
*Previous consultancy or highly regulated industry experience is desirable
